The Importance of Responsible Gaming Features

A responsible gaming platform proactively incorporates features designed to help players manage their gaming habits and prevent potential problems. These features can include de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and reality checks that remind players how long they’ve been playing. Providing access to resources and support for problem gambling is also a critical aspect of responsible gaming. Platforms that prioritize player well-being demonstrate a commitment to ethical practices and build trust with their user base. Furthermore, proactive identification and intervention strategies can assist individuals who may be developing unhealthy gaming behaviors. This inclusion of comprehensive tools is a telling sign of a platform’s intention and the value it places on its player base.

Navigating the Complexities of Online Payment Systems

A secure and reliable payment system is arguably the most critical aspect of any online gaming platform. Players need to be confident that their financial information is protected and that transactions are processed smoothly and efficiently. A diverse range of payment options is also important, catering to different preferences and geographical locations. This can include credit and debit cards, e-wallets, bank transfers, and even cryptocurrencies. The platform should utilize industry-standard encryption technologies,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), to protect sensitive data during transmission. Regular security audits and compliance with PCI DSS (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ard) are essential for maintaining a secure payment environment. It's also important to clearly display the platform's security protocols and privacy policies, fostering transparency and trust.

Understanding Transaction Fees and Processing Times

Before making a deposit or withdrawal, players should carefully review the platform’s terms and conditions regarding transaction fees and processing times. Some platforms may charge fees for certain payment methods or for withdrawals below a certain threshold. Processing times can vary depending on the payment method chosen, with e-wallets typically offering faster withdrawals than bank transfers. Transparency in these areas is crucial for avoiding misunderstandings and ensuring a positive financial experience. A well-designed platform will clearly outline all fees and processing times upfront, allowing players to make informed decisions. A lack of this information is a red flag and should prompt further investigation.

  • Credit/Debit Cards: Widely accepted, generally secure, can have moderate processing times.
  • E-W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ller): Fast withdrawals, higher security, sometimes subject to fees.
  • Bank Transfers: Reliable, often slower processing times, may have higher minimum withdrawal limits.
  • Cryptocurrencies: Increasing in popularity, fast and secure, can be subject to volatility.

Emerging Technologies Shaping the Future of Online Gaming

The online gaming industry is constantly evolving, driven by advancements in technology.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) are poised to revolutionize the gaming experience, offering immersive and interactive environments. Blockchain technology and non-fungible tokens (NFTs) are also gaining traction, enabling new forms of ownership and monetization within games. Artificial intelligence (AI) is being used to enhance game design, personalize player experiences, and detect fraudulent activity. Cloud gaming is eliminating the need for expensive hardware, allowing players to stream games directly to their devices. These emerging technologies are creating exciting new possibilities for both players and developers, pushing the boundaries of what’s possible in the world of online gaming.
